**Key Ceremony Checklist — Item 4 (Userhive Split)**

As part of extracting the user module from the Ossmere monolith into the new Userhive service, the reviewer must confirm that the legacy credential table export was destroyed after migration and that dual-control signatures are recorded. Once both are verified, initialize the Userhive root keyslot with the recovery passphrase below.

recovery phrase for baweg-faweg: zorael-framir

**Ticket: Config drift — Hallwhisper audio guide**

Visitors at the Brundle Museum report stale tour content on kiosk-provisioned devices. Root cause: the kiosk fleet drifted from the canonical config after the March rollout; they still point at the retired content bucket. Support: do not hand-edit devices. Re-provision against the canonical values. Canonical configuration for the production fleet is as follows.

settings of hahif-tagaf:
CASION_PIN=2161
CASION_TENANT=lamael
CASION_METRICS_HOST=metrics.casion.urlaqsoft.internal
CASION_SEAL=seal_a7b908e4
CASION_STANDBY_TEAM=casdor

# Break-Glass: Catalog Cache Invalidation

Scope: the Pinrow product catalog at Veldstone Retail. If stale prices persist after a purge and the Hollowmere invalidation queue is wedged, use break-glass to flush the edge tier directly. Contractors: get verbal sign-off from the catalog lead first. Steps: open the Hollowmere admin shell, select emergency-flush, confirm the tenant, and run it once — repeated flushes thrash the origin. Access is logged and expires after 20 minutes. Unseal the admin shell with the passphrase below.

recovery phrase for kahop-tajog: istix-casvan

## Changelog — Tidemark Widget 3.2

Defaults changed. Read before touching anything.

- Refresh interval now hourly, not every 15 min. Harbor feeds from the Pellisport aggregator throttle aggressive polling.
- Lunar-offset correction is on by default. Disable only for legacy Kestrel Bay deployments.
- Chart units default to metric. The imperial fallback flag is deprecated and will be removed in 3.4.
- Cache eviction is now time-based, not size-based.

New installs should start from the default configuration values listed below.

config for kahap-taweg:
oliox:
  pin: 8609
  tenant: casath
  seal: seal_632a4a6f
  metrics_host: metrics.oliox.nelvrogrid.example
  standby_team: keleth
  escalation: briiel-oliwyn
  nonce: e2397c